To the op if you go that is too bad, but I agree not everyone will find every forum 'home'. There are a few forums that I just don't fit in at. (ie everyone loves one style of training and no one is allowed to say anything else, not even to have a spirited debate...) If this forum and its members bother you then by all means find somewhere else to hang out.

If you do think you want to stay, wait a couple of days and re read that thread. It seemed you were taking a lot of things personally, things that weren't even directed at you as a person. Around here a thread is like a conversation at a party. It might start with a couple of people and on one topic, but as people join and comment it can take interesting turns. That has nothing to do with the person who started it. Also if you stick around you can see that people who are friends, actual friends, can have opposing opinions. And as long as no one dismisses the other one's opinion (or mistakes opinions as facts, facts are what you back up your opinions with....) we get some good rip roarin debates. But its not personal.

Not everyone can handle that and assume disagreement = dislike.
